Weed research has turned a corner, Leafly nation, empirically confirming what we all already knew—cannabis is a potent aphrodisiac. An increasing number of Americans pair weed and sex every year, with better results than ever. How do we know?

For starters, humanity has touted weed’s arousing qualities for thousands of years, well before legal prohibition and social stigma for both cannabis and intimacy. New studies indicate that most people who bring ganja to the bedroom report more frequent and intense orgasms, as well as overall enhanced sensitivity. What’s different now is product diversity—anyone wanting a roll in the hay can choose from flowers, vapes, edibles, and plenty of juicy topicals. Plus, we have the freedom to share what works and doesn’t for the first time. In 2024, we have 24 adult-use cannabis states nationwide and historic levels of decriminalization.

So this year, Leafly triangulated data from more than 6,000 strains, 4,000 store menus, hundreds of thousands of user reviews, and first-hand anecdotes from our network of cannabis experts to determine the best strains for sex. Tough work, if you can get it. But dry? Never.

Candy Rain by Moon Valley Cannabis is a lush and languid sensory experience. Everything about this flower is turned all the way up, from its crystalline bud structure and other worldly high, to a complex terpene profile that’s heavy on the gas with notes of lilac, pine, and wet earth. 

Moon Valley Cannabis grows fire cultivars like this popular London Pound Cake x Gelato cross indoors in “living soil,” meaning large troughs of soil alive with mycelium, beneficial insects and companion plants. They also implement Korean natural farming techniques like fermenting all their inputs in-house. 

With its mind-quieting and physically titillating high, Candy Rain is a perfect pick for a sexy night like Valentine’s Day. Roll up. A sumptuous evening awaits. — Lindsay MaHarry

Love Affair, the cross of Alien Rock Candy and GG4 eschews lovey-dovey florals for heart-pounding, animalistic scents. The crew at Pacific Grove coaxed plenty of nuance out of this clone-only offering from Western Solventless Technology. Halitosis and body odor compete against diesel fuel and black peppercorn in a bouquet that wrinkles the nose while it raises an eyebrow.

The scent is a perfect match for the effect, less suited for rose petals on the bed and geared more toward the center of a crowded dance floor at the after-after party. Rich in caryophyllene, this arousing strain offers relaxation without tipping into sedative territory. —Ryan Herron

Your sweet tooth will thank you for rolling up Biskante—you and your significant other will be drooling over each other, high on the heat.

Made from Melonade x Biscotti #6, the Biskante offers up the sugary-sweet diesel flavor signature to Biscotti coupled with the luminous lemon of Melonade, thanks to its dominant terpenes limonene and beta-caryophyllene. Biskante takes these pleasant dessert flavors and turns it up to 11, coating the mouth with sugary sweetness. This batch tested high at 32.65% THC and 0.07% CBD, a knock-out cultivar to gift your knock-out partner. —Lindsey Bartlett

Donut Shop is bred by Fig Farms and picked from their 2023 pheno hunt, with a genetic lineage of Holy Moly! x Gelato 41. You can taste the love that Oakland-based Fig puts into its craft. The flavor is as decadent and creamy as a heart-shaped Krispy Kreme.

Its lime green and white trichome-packed peaks and valleys offer a refreshing flavor profile to the California marketplace. A true indulgence, the dry hit is reminiscent of powdered sugar donuts mixed with something funky and floral.
